Debra A. Olmsted Obituary

With solemn hearts, we announce the passing of Debra A. Olmsted (Waupaca, Wisconsin), whose presence will be deeply missed, having departed on May 4, 2025. Family and friends are welcome to leave their condolences on this memorial page and share them with the family.

She was predeceased by: her parents, Leo Martens and Marie Martens; her brother Michael Martens; her parents-in-law, Arlyn and Ruby Olmsted; and her siblings-in-law, Bill Olmsted (Mary Lou), Jerome Olmsted and Barbara Shampers.

She is survived by: her husband Thomas Olmsted; her daughters, Carli Hopf (Nic) and Taylor Cada (Matt); her grandchildren, Baylor and Baker; and her siblings, Jean Graef (Bill), John Martens, Cora Haltaufderheid (Rick), Richard Martens (Kathy) and Judy Martens. She is also survived by many loving nieces, nephews, life-long friends.

A celebration of life will be held on Friday, May 9th 2025 from 3:00 PM to 6:45 PM and at 7:00 PM at the A. J. Holly & Sons (526 S Main St, Waupaca, WI 54981).

In lieu of flowers, Debbie would want you to thrift something fabulous, eat dessert first, sing James Taylor at the top of your lungs, and always wear a white t-shirt (with a food stain on the chest).
